Why start-up development strategy should not depend on freelancer


Posted March 1, 2023 by Checkmateq

Checkmate Global Technologies offers Digital Transformation, product engineering, cloud, software development services to startups, SMBs and enterprises.

 
Software development has advanced significantly in recent years. Businesses ultimately need to hire software engineers in almost every field. The complete company is then thrown into a challenging situation at that point.
The process of developing software is challenging and unpredictable. Product development managers are highly motivated to choose a software development team to carry out different initiatives. For their software project, they have two hiring options: freelancers or a specialised offshore product development team. However, depending on a number of factors, each has pros and cons of its own. Both deliver the job without a doubt, but in the case of IT development, that is not the only requirement.
The decision of employing freelancers or dedicated developers has already become significantly more important in terms of producing mobile applications, web development, and software infrastructure support. The decision must be carefully evaluated in view of the organization's requirements, timetables, and financial constraints. In this piece, we'll compare the two software development methodologies and show why, in the majority of startups, an expert offshore dedicated development team is desirable.
Remote Software Development: What Is It?
Simply put, an offshore software engineering team is one that you employ to work on your software development project from a different reputable digital transformation consultant company. When the organisation in responsibility for the digital transformation is located abroad, offshore software development is one type of collaboration that takes place.
Choosing an offshore software team refers to selecting a team of experts from locations other than your company headquarters. The offshore software development team may operate in various time zones due to a significant time difference. Additionally, they must modify their shift if required to meet your needs.
Customers from various Western nations, for instance, use India as a hub for offshore software development. Offshoring should not be mistaken for outsourcing, though. Outsourcing denotes the management of your organization's operations by staff from a business associate. Although they don't operate out of the corporate headquarters, your business does hire an offshore product management and service team.
This group is technically your employees and is similar to in-house personnel.
However, unlike employees, you are free to focus on the company without having to worry about issues with payments, salaries, or welfare programs. You can instead focus on more important production-related issues and delegate the remainder to your digital development partners.
What do freelance developers do?
A freelance developer is a self-employed software programmer who operates on various tasks for clients. These professionals write code and manage operations for the software tasks they choose to work on. The freelancer establishes the specifics of each task, such as the number of hours to be produced and the wage levels. Many independent coders take on a variety of projects because they have the freedom to choose which ones they want to work on.
Smaller companies frequently use freelancers to carry out tasks for them because they may not have enough work to justify hiring full-time developers or are unable to afford to do so.
Regular tasks for independent software engineers include the following:
designing application systems
providing clients with advice and implementing software upgrades
creating websites using code, identifying customers, and contacting them to determine their requirements
Freelance software engineers work on short-term and medium-term contracts for one or more companies and bill by the hour. This means that although they are not workers of the company, they work on specific tasks and projects that the freelancer has agreed to.


What Sets a Dedicated Offshore Development Company Apart From Freelancers?
In order to streamline the task and deliver a high-end result, the SMEs put in a lot of effort and use enterprise-grade level technology and solutions. For any sort of organisation, working with a seasoned offshore software engineering development team has many benefits.
Following are a few of the most notable benefits:


Resources
When you hire offshore product developers for software development, digital transformation organisations make sure to provide support from their end to help you finish your project. For businesses, it's important to prioritise meeting customer requirements. Along with other criteria, they will ensure that their regular IT operations have all the tools necessary to produce the desired software product.
Digital transformation companies will provide superior product development teams if you require them. If you hire the best offshore product developers through them, you can offer your software engineering employees multiple tasks at once without worrying about them completing everything on time.
Availability
When working on a software project, you can expect the offshore software developer to be available at all times so you can employ them to work whenever you need them. They will be helpful and available to talk to you whenever you need them. This is one of the main advantages of using an outsourced product development team.
Specialist
Regardless of your line of employment, proficiency is crucial.
Before employing product developers, it is essential to consider their skills. Choose candidates with pertinent experience who have finished similar software projects to yours.
Every situation, from operating under time constraints to creating the highest quality output, will benefit from the expertise of offshore production developers. Offshore dedicated developers typically have more knowledge than freelance workers because they collaborate with different team members in a business environment and gain knowledge along the way.
In opposition to freelancers, who act as the team's extensions, offshore software developers work together as a team to collect essential knowledge and expertise that is only possible within the framework of an organisation.
Competence
When you hire an offshore dedicated development group to collaborate on your software project, you can be confident that the work will be of a high standard because they go through an onboarding process throughout a digital transformation company to ensure they have the skills required for the job. Because they plan on developing a long-term relationship with your company, offshore software teams are more reliable than freelancers.
A freelancer, on the opposite hand, works on multiple tasks at once, so you can't be sure of their commitment. They might be overly fixated on a different endeavour that might be more intriguing to them because they have too many competing priorities.
Expenditure
When you compare the costs of employing offshore workers versus independent contractors, you'll see that putting together a skilled offshore software development team is the better choice.
While freelancers typically charge by the hour or job, offshore product developers are going to be on your salary and receive a salary from you on a monthly basis.
Engagement
Collaboration is one of a company's most important elements. No matter how skilled your engineers are, if you can't connect with them, you won't be capable of working with them.
You will be able to contact offshore dedicated production engineers more quickly and via a variety of communication channels, allowing you to alert them as soon as possible to any changes or requirements.
Freelancers will need a lot more flexibility, and because they are working on numerous software projects at once, they won't be as available as dedicated developers.
Safety
Security is of the utmost significance in business. You can't merely hire any software developer to finish the assignment because sharing sensitive information with someone you don't trust can be disastrous.
Your business's privacy as well as the software project's privacy may be in danger. To locate a dedicated offshore product developer, a recruitment process should be used, and a contract should be signed. Both employers and workers sign nondisclosure agreements that must be followed at all times after being hired.

You can discover developers for your development project using a variety of methods. It might be an offshore software developer, a contract worker, or a full-time foreign employee. The deciding factors will be your requirements and resources. However, using a dedicated offshore software development team instead of hiring independent freelancers has a number of advantages.

Having looked at the advantages, are you now considering employing an offshore software developer? It would be a good idea to explore Checkmate Global Technologies. We will support your business every step of the way as a company that specialises in digital transition to help it realise the highest profits and levels of security.
-- END ---
Share Facebook Twitter
Print Friendly and PDF DisclaimerReport Abuse
Contact Email [email protected]
Issued By Checkamteq
Phone +919148781818
Business Address Kormangla,4th block
Bangalore, KA, 560034
Country India
Categories Open Source , Outdoors , Personal Interests
Tags cloud , hire remote developer , offshore product development , devops , hire dedicated developer
Last Updated March 1, 2023